Overview

Sushi Purasu is a takeaway restaurant located in the city of Adelaide, offering quick, high-quality Japanese meals — from sushi to rice bowls and ramen. The brand is designed to reflect speed, freshness, and quality, catering to the fast-paced lifestyle of urban professionals.

Key Contributions

  • I led the branding design, including logo creation, colour palette development, and overall visual identity. The goal was to create a clean, modern, and approachable aesthetic that resonates with the local white-collar audience.

Challenges

  • The main challenge was to craft a distinctive and contemporary Japanese-inspired identity that appeals to business professionals while maintaining cultural authenticity and visual simplicity suitable for a takeaway setting.

Outcomes

  • The new branding direction positions Sushi Purasu as a fresh, high-quality, and efficient choice for Adelaide’s city workers. The refined visual identity enhances brand recognition and appeal among its target audience.
